Lines Matching refs:chain_index
347 u32 chain_index)
359 chain->index = chain_index;
442 u32 chain_index)
449 if (chain->index == chain_index)
457 u32 chain_index)
462 if (chain->index == chain_index)
473 u32 chain_index, bool create,
480 chain = tcf_chain_lookup(block, chain_index);
486 chain = tcf_chain_create(block, chain_index);
512 static struct tcf_chain *tcf_chain_get(struct tcf_block *block, u32 chain_index,
515 return __tcf_chain_get(block, chain_index, create, false);
518 struct tcf_chain *tcf_chain_get_by_act(struct tcf_block *block, u32 chain_index)
520 return __tcf_chain_get(block, chain_index, true, true);
527 void *tmplt_priv, u32 chain_index,
1957 u32 chain_index;
2039 chain_index = tca[TCA_CHAIN] ? nla_get_u32(tca[TCA_CHAIN]) : 0;
2040 if (chain_index > TC_ACT_EXT_VAL_MASK) {
2045 chain = tcf_chain_get(block, chain_index, true);
2186 u32 chain_index;
2248 chain_index = tca[TCA_CHAIN] ? nla_get_u32(tca[TCA_CHAIN]) : 0;
2249 if (chain_index > TC_ACT_EXT_VAL_MASK) {
2254 chain = tcf_chain_get(block, chain_index, false);
2346 u32 chain_index;
2404 chain_index = tca[TCA_CHAIN] ? nla_get_u32(tca[TCA_CHAIN]) : 0;
2405 if (chain_index > TC_ACT_EXT_VAL_MASK) {
2410 chain = tcf_chain_get(block, chain_index, false);
2650 void *tmplt_priv, u32 chain_index,
2680 if (nla_put_u32(skb, TCA_CHAIN, chain_index))
2731 void *tmplt_priv, u32 chain_index,
2743 if (tc_chain_fill_node(tmplt_ops, tmplt_priv, chain_index, net, skb,
2811 u32 chain_index;
2838 chain_index = tca[TCA_CHAIN] ? nla_get_u32(tca[TCA_CHAIN]) : 0;
2839 if (chain_index > TC_ACT_EXT_VAL_MASK) {
2846 chain = tcf_chain_lookup(block, chain_index);
2865 chain = tcf_chain_create(block, chain_index);
3605 entry->chain_index = tcf_gact_goto_chain_index(act);